#ifndef ANTKEEPER_GEOM_QUADTREE_HPP
#define ANTKEEPER_GEOM_QUADTREE_HPP
#include "geom/hyperoctree.hpp"
#include <cstdint>
namespace geom {
/// A quadtree, or 2-dimensional hyperoctree.
template <std::unsigned_integral T, hyperoctree_order Order>
using quadtree = hyperoctree<T, 2, Order>;
/// Quadtree with an 8-bit node type (2 depth levels).
template <hyperoctree_order Order>
using quadtree8 = quadtree<std::uint8_t, Order>;
/// Quadtree with a 16-bit node type (6 depth levels).
template <hyperoctree_order Order>
using quadtree16 = quadtree<std::uint16_t, Order>;
/// Quadtree with a 32-bit node type (13 depth levels).
template <hyperoctree_order Order>
using quadtree32 = quadtree<std::uint32_t, Order>;
/// Quadtree with a 64-bit node type (29 depth levels).
template <hyperoctree_order Order>
using quadtree64 = quadtree<std::uint64_t, Order>;
/// Quadtree with unordered node storage and traversal.
template <std::unsigned_integral T>
using unordered_quadtree = quadtree<T, hyperoctree_order::unordered>;
/// Unordered quadtree with an 8-bit node type (2 depth levels).
typedef unordered_quadtree<std::uint8_t> unordered_quadtree8;
/// Unordered quadtree with a 16-bit node type (6 depth levels).
typedef unordered_quadtree<std::uint16_t> unordered_quadtree16;
/// Unordered quadtree with a 32-bit node type (13 depth levels).
typedef unordered_quadtree<std::uint32_t> unordered_quadtree32;
/// Unordered quadtree with a 64-bit node type (29 depth levels).
typedef unordered_quadtree<std::uint64_t>unordered_quadtree64;
} // namespace geom
#endif // ANTKEEPER_GEOM_QUADTREE_HPP
